Plantain Flour For Vibratory Sifter

The principle of the plantain flour strong>vibratory sifter is to use the vibration force of the motor to cause the screen to vibrate at high frequencies. The raw materials enter the upper part of the vibrating screen. Due to the vibration force, larger particles will be blocked by the screen, while smaller particles will fall through the screen into the collecting port below. By adjusting the amplitude and frequency of the vibrating screen, materials of different particle sizes can be screened.

Key Challenges in Plantain Flour Screening and Our Solutions

Plantain flour presents unique screening challenges due to its high starch and fiber content. Here are the three main issues processors face:

Clumping: Plantain flour readily absorbs moisture from the air, forming hard lumps that clog screens and compromise product quality.

High Fiber Content: The fibrous nature of plantain causes particles to tangle and block mesh openings, reducing effective screening area.

High Fineness Requirements: Premium plantain flour demands extremely fine and uniform particle sizes. Industry research indicates an ideal average particle size of approximately 236μm (about 60 mesh), while high-end applications may require 120 mesh or finer.

Our Targeted Solutions:

For Clumping: Our vibratory sifters can be equipped with an ultrasonic deblinding system. High-frequency ultrasonic energy actively breaks down soft agglomerates and prevents fine particles from blinding the mesh, ensuring efficient screening at high mesh counts.

For Fiber Tangling: We install bounce balls or rubber cleaning rings inside the machine. These continuously strike the screen surface during operation, effectively dislodging tangled fibers and adhered particles to maintain consistent throughput.

For High-Precision Grading: Our machines feature high-quality stainless steel screens available from 40 to 325 mesh. Combined with adjustable vibration amplitude and frequency, we help you achieve precise particle size control—whether you ne ed 236μm for standard markets or finer grades for specialty applications.

Technical Specification & Selection Guide for Plantain Flour Vibratory Sifters

Model Screen Mesh Throughput Motor Power Recommended Application
DH-600 40-80 mesh 100-300 kg/h 0.55 kW Small-scale production or lab use; ideal for coarse impurities and fiber removal.
DH-1000 60-120 mesh 300-800 kg/h 1.1 kW Medium-scale production; suitable for baking-grade or baby food-grade plantain flour requiring finer particle sizes.
DH-1200 80-200 mesh/td> 500-1200 kg/h 1.5 kW Large-scale industrial production; can be paired with ultrasonic system to handle sticky, clumping materials efficiently.

Note: Actual throughput varies based on material moisture content, fiber percentage, and mesh size. Please consult our engineers for customized recommendations.
